Obituary of Ozelma Marie Epps

Ozelma “Tink” Epps, also known to many as Nanny, 93, of Prunedale, passed away Thursday, January 14, 2021.  She was born April 8, 1927 in Danville, Arkansas and lived there until she moved to Guadalupe, CA in 1944, where she met her husband.  They were married in 1945 and moved to Salinas in 1946 and had been married for 66 years before his passing in 2011.

 

They followed the produce between Salinas and El Centro, and she worked in the produce sheds for many years until their retirements in 1978.  At that time, they started selling tools at the Red Barn Flea Market on the weekends and she loved every minute of it; meeting all the people and making new friends.  She was always there for her family and anyone that needed her, and she treated everyone as if they were her best friend.  She loved her family very much and loved seeing them and spending time with all of them and she really loved travelling to see her family in and out of state as much as she could.  In her younger years they owned a mink farm and raised and sold mink, owned and operated a roping arena and her favorite hobbies were raising and selling geraniums, camping and fishing.
